I listen to KNX newsradio here in Los Angeles. There is a show called Money 101. Usually the advice is good, but a week or so ago, they talked about getting an upgrade by dressing nicely and talking up the gate agent.

I am afraid that many people listening to the show got the wrong idea. That advice is way out of date. Upgrades are a valuable commodity and carefully guarded. Any gate agent who upgrades a passenger just because they asked nicely and wore expensive clothes would probably receive disciplinary action.
